CC -!- FUNCTION: Component of the proteasome, a multicatalytic proteinase
CC complex which is characterized by its ability to cleave peptides with
CC Arg, Phe, Tyr, Leu, and Glu adjacent to the leaving group at neutral or
CC slightly basic pH. The proteasome has an ATP-dependent proteolytic
CC activity. {ECO:0000256|RuleBase:RU004203}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=Cleavage of peptide bonds with very broad specificity.;
CC EC=3.4.25.1; Evidence={ECO:0000256|ARBA:ARBA00001198};
CC -!- SUBUNIT: Component of the proteasome complex.
CC {ECO:0000256|RuleBase:RU004203}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|RuleBase:RU004203}.
CC Nucleus {ECO:0000256|RuleBase:RU004203}.
CC -!- SIMILARITY: Belongs to the peptidase T1B family.
CC {ECO:0000256|RuleBase:RU004203}.
